Overview

The rotor motor core is the rotating part of an electric motor or generator, typically made from laminated silicon steel sheets to reduce eddy current losses. It works in tandem with the stator to enable electromechanical energy conversion through electromagnetic induction. Modern cores are precision-engineered with thin laminations (0.1-0.5mm) coated with insulating material to minimize energy loss. Their design directly impacts motor efficiency, torque characteristics, and thermal performance in applications ranging from industrial machinery to electric vehicles.

Structure and Working Principle

A rotor core consists of hundreds of stamped steel laminations stacked and riveted/welded together, forming slots for copper/aluminum windings or permanent magnets. The laminations are insulated with oxide or varnish coatings to prevent interlayer current flow. When current flows through stator windings, it creates a rotating magnetic field that induces eddy currents in the rotor core. The interaction between these fields generates torque. Advanced designs may include skewed slots or flux barriers to reduce cogging torque and harmonic losses.

Key Features

High-grade electrical steels (e.g., M19, M22) with 2-3% silicon content are preferred for their optimal balance of magnetic saturation and resistivity. Grain-oriented steel may be used in high-efficiency applications. Critical parameters include lamination thickness (thinner reduces losses but increases cost), stacking factor (typically 95-97%), and core loss (measured in W/kg at specified frequencies). Modern cores often feature laser-cut geometries for precision and may include cooling channels in high-power applications.

Application Areas

Rotor cores are ubiquitous in AC induction motors (60% of market), permanent magnet synchronous motors (growing in EVs), and wound-rotor machines for industrial applications. Specific uses include: - Automotive: Traction motors in EVs, starter motors - Industrial: Pumps, compressors, CNC machinery - Appliances: Refrigerator compressors, washing machine motors - Energy: Wind turbine generators, hydroelectric systems Specialized versions exist for high-speed (up to 100,000 RPM) or high-temperature (up to 200°C) environments.

Maintenance and Precautions

Proper handling prevents core damage that degrades performance. Laminations must remain insulated - any scratches or burrs can create short circuits. Moisture protection is critical to prevent rust between layers. During motor assembly, uniform stacking pressure (typically 1-2 MPa) must be maintained to avoid air gaps. Periodic inspection should check for discoloration (overheating signs) or loose laminations causing abnormal noise. In repair scenarios, original stacking sequence must be preserved during disassembly.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ing rotor cores, specify: 1. Electrical steel grade (e.g., 50WW600) 2. Stack height tolerance (±0.1mm standard) 3. Insulation coating type (C3, C5, etc.) 4. Balancing requirements (G2.5 common) Leading manufacturers include POSCO, Nippon Steel, and ThyssenKrupp for materials, with specialized fabricators in China, Germany, and Japan. MOQs typically start at 500 units for standard sizes. Lead times vary from 4-12 weeks depending on customization. Always request core loss test reports for high-efficiency applications.
